Suspected World War II ordnance explodes in Indonesia, five dead
Suspected World War II ordnance explodes in Indonesia, five dead JAKARTA: A suspected shell left over from World War II exploded under a stilt house in an Indonesian fishing village, killing five people and wounding nearly 20, police said on Monday (Jun 1). The blast in Indonesia's restive eastern Papua region startled locals with a thunderous boom on Sunday afternoon, emitting a ball of flames followed by a thick smoke column, according to footage broadcast on Kompas TV.

The bad blood between Poland and Ukraine left over from World War II
Poland is weighing whether to strip Ukrainian President Volodymyr Zelenskyy of its top honour for renaming an army unit after Ukrainian nationalist insurgents who massacred Poles in World War II. The decision caused a chorus of outrage in Warsaw and led President Karol Nawrocki to call for Zelenskyy to be stripped of the Order of the White Eagle, which he was awarded in 2023.
